AFC Oaklands win as League champions

Oaklands’ very own semi-professional football team AFC Oaklands are celebrating a double win this year – reigning top of the league for the Herts Senior League and Herts Senior Cup.

Wednesday night’s game resulted in a 1-1 draw against Bengeo Trinity FC, securing the League Championship title. They make history by being the first ever team to take the double  – a victory made even sweeter by the fact the team have secured both titles in their debut year.

The semi-pro team, which is based at Oaklands College St Albans Campus are already looking ahead to their plans next year for the premier division. AFC Oaklands is the semi pro arm of elite football academy EDSV, which hosts a portfolio of teams spanning ladies, men’s and various ages.

AFC Manager Billy Highton said:  “To not only win the double but to do it is our first year is an incredible achievement and reflects the hard work, enthusiasm and professionalism of our players.

“It’s a fantastic kick start to our competitive life and we can’t wait to move on to the premier division.

Both wins show the calibre of players we are developing and their potential to go on and excel at higher levels in professional football.”
